Demands Intensify for Razor-Wire Fence Around Capitol to Come Down

Demands Intensify for Security Fence Around Capitol to Come Down Forty-two House Republicans want Speaker of the House Nancy Pelosi (D-Calif.) to take down the razor-wire-topped steel barrier surrounding the U.S. Capitol complex and send the troops manning it home as soon as possible. “We write with concerns about the security measures and enhanced fencing around the U.S. Capitol even though high-profile events like the inauguration are over,” the group said in a Feb. 5 letter to Pelosi. �...

Biden ousts Trump's union busters from the Federal Service Impasses Panel.

On Tuesday, Joe Biden demanded the resignations of all 10 of Donald Trump’s appointees to the Federal Service Impasses Panel, a powerful labor relations board, in a major victory for federal unions. Eight members resigned, and two were fired after refusing to step down. Trump’s appointees—a group of partisan anti-labor activists—had hobbled federal unions for years, sabotaging their ability to organize and bargain collectively. NAB lands Westpac's consumer bank CIO - Finance - Training & Development

By Ry Crozier on Jan 29, 2021 12:40PM Anastasia Cammaroto. Joins as CIO of personal banking. NAB has landed Westpac’s former consumer bank CIO Anastasia Cammaroto to lead technology across its own personal banking operations. iTnews can now reveal that she has been appointed as CIO of personal banking, sitting in NAB’s technology and enterprise operations division. This is why German author Uwe Johnson spent the last years of his life in Sheerness

This is why German author Uwe Johnson spent the last years of his life in Sheerness  |  Updated: 07:14, 22 January 2021 Towards the end of 1974, a stranger arrived in the small town of Sheerness on the Isle of Sheppey. He could often be found sitting on a favourite stool at the bar of the Napier pub, drinking Hurlimann lager and smoking French Gauloises cigarettes while flicking through the pages of the local paper. Camden National Bank donates Gardiner buildings

Camden National Bank donates Gardiner buildings Gardiner Main Street plans a $2.5 million renovation of the five Water Street buildings. 4 of 4 Camden National Bank announced on Wednesday the donation of several buildings to Gardiner Main Street. Gardiner Main Street hopes the 19th-century buildings eventually will be redeveloped into studio and living space for artists and an expansion of the groups collaborative work space.
